Pre-Camp Info for Parents
• Registration Sign-In is on Sunday afternoons from 4:00 to 5:00 pm in Town Hall. Please drive to the far end of camp past the cabins to the big brown building above the pond.
• Pick Up/Banquet & Awards Ceremony: You may pick up and load up Friday between 4:30-4:45 pm to cabin area for loading. Please do not pull all the way up to the cabins. Then join us for a banquet, video presentation, and awards ceremony. Banquet starts at 5:00 pm and typically ends 6:00-6:30 pm. $5.00 donation per person - kids 6 and under eat free
• Are all your forms signed and completed? If parent/guardian will not be present at registration, others are not permitted to sign any forms at sign-in.
• All forms and final payment should have been received by office prior to start of camp. Any exceptions must be cleared by office prior to arrival.
• Spending money: Bring to registration and money will be put on a spending card. Any remaining funds will be returned at the end of camp. Please do not leave this with camper.
• Camp Store: T-shirts, Hoodies, camp apparel etc... can be purchased in advance or at registration.
• Medications: Bring to registration at Town Hall. Please do not pack with your belongings. Parent must sign "Medication Instructions Release" (page 4 of Reg form)
• Health/Illness: Please monitor your child/children the week before camp for any signs of illness that could put your child or others at risk.
• Head Lice: Please check your child prior to camp and treat if applicable. A head lice check will be done at sign-in, so please do not move into cabin before this step is completed.
• Camper Packing List: Review before your child's camp date and be prepared. Any storage bin that is 7in high or less will fit under the bunks and are great to pack your child's things in!!
• Cell Phones and Electronics: Please DO NOT bring these to camp. They are a distraction & may be damaged. Your child can call home if they wish from a staff or camp phone. You will also be provided numbers to get in contact with us or your child if necessary or for emergencies.
• Riding Boots: Please call the office to inquire about borrowing a pair of used boots or availability of new or gently used boots to purchase for a minimal fee.
